Tristan Shu Paris sports photographers

Tristan Shu is based at the heart of the french Alps, near Geneva, and his photography covers sports and action, aerial, landscape, interiors, advertising, portrait and lifestyle.

His contrast-laden, colourful and action-packed shots have gained him worlwide recogniton and publication in magazines including National Geographic, Courier International, Paris Match, GQ. Brands like The North Face, Quiksilver, Vacheron-Constantin, ESPN and X Games also use his services.

Very at ease with extreme sports and disciplines he has never previously shot, Tristan has developed a signature style and is an international ambassador for a flash manufacturer.

Arnaud Février Paris corporate & industrial photographers

Arnaud Fevrier is a French photographer based in Paris. He began freelancing in 1993, working in Lisbon, Beirut and Riga and had his images published in Geo and Gallimard city guides. Between 1990-97, he shot concerts for Jean Michel Jarre, and collaborated with the Imapress agency until 1998 through a number of reports highlighting the humanitarian disasters in Gaza and Iraq.

His work was published in a variety of newspapers before he turned more towards portraiture, joining the team at the MPA agency where he stayed until 2004. In parallel with his press assignments, Arnaud developed a strong relationship with communications agencies to produce reports highlighting the men and women who make up today's societies. Attempting to reveal people's privacy, he photographs refined portraits, yet remains fascinated by the world of industry, transport and energy; for Arnaud, models have been replaced by planes, trains and boats.

Attracted by the moving image, he made his first video reports for Alstom Transport who entrusted him with the production of a film on a new high-speed train for Poland in 2014. Arnaud is a member of the collective Bloomartists which includes photographers, retouchers and make-up artists from across Europe.

Pascal Raso Paris beauty photographers

Currently based in Paris, Pascal Raso usually works in studio but can also work pretty much anywhere in the world. He is specialised in advertising, beauty, editorial and artistic photography and is known to have creative vision by transcending the simplicity and limitations of a basic technical style.

Since becoming a professional photographer, Pascal has consistently aimed to deliver a strong impression within his photographs while maintaining a theme that is appropriate to what is asked from him. Providing top quality and expertise for each of its photographs, his creative mind is only topped by his artistic drawing abilities.

Conti Sud Productions Paris photo production

Since 2007, Montpellier-based Conti Sud Productions has been offering all inclusive production services ranging from scouting services to crew booking, casting and set design, providing whatever is needed to ensure a successful shoot.

Through a wide network of partner companies around the world, Conti Sud Productions guarantees top quality services and efficient cost solutions for productions worldwide.

Conti Sud Productions offers more than 500 houses to rent for photos in France, Belgium, Ibiza, Bali and all over the world.

Eyesee Paris photo production

EyeSee is a Paris-based full service production company working throughout France and worldwide across advertising, editorial, fashion and corporate industries. The company also produces moving images, essentially online brand content, following clients' needs and budget.

EyeSee collaborates with clients at every stage of the creative process, providing art buying, casting, location scouting, budget management, accommodation, transportation, crew booking, catering and equipment rental.

Whatever the request, the company's team of highly skilled producers strives to make every production a stress-free experience. Enthusiastic, efficient and cost-effective defines EyeSee's way of working, with the company offering seamless solutions tailored to each individual client.

JPPS Paris photo production

Based in Paris and run by Jacqueline Pusch and John Fanning, JPPS offers global production consulting for advertising and editorial shoots of all sizes. Its vast experience and reliable international network allows for successful shoots worldwide.

Over the years, the pair's unrelenting enthusiasm, energy and endurance has been appreciated by clients including Swarovski, Hanro, Louis Vuitton, Hugo Boss, Max Mara, Sunglass Hut, Harper's Bazaar, Harrods, GQ, Glamour, Vogue, Dazed & Confused, Zeit, H&M, Red Bull, Repetto, Diesel, Manor, Boden, Holt Renfrew, BMW, Renault, Citroën, Peugeot, IBM, Allianz, Lufthansa, Philip Morris, Perrier and Rolex.

JPPS also offers creative services for video-making, Internet spots and behind the scenes photography.

KA2 Productions Paris photo production

KA2 Productions is a full service photographic and video production company working within the advertising and fashion industries.

The company offers a range of services including photographic and video production, budget management, on site co-ordination, location scouting, casting, art buying, equipment hire, transport and accommodation.

Recent clients include Piaget, Simone Pérèle, Crédit Suisse, Leroy Merlin, Bonobo, Jules, ERDF and Christian Louboutin.

Octopix Paris photo production

Created in 1999, Octopix is a full service production company based in Paris. Octopix provides experienced multilingual coordinators, friendly assistants and effective technicians to make shoots run as smoothly as possible.

The agency offers the largest location database in France and loves the challenge of finding that "impossible" location in France and throughout the world. Octopix also includes casting and set design services.

The agency adapts to creative and budget expectations for clients as diverse as Louis Vuitton, Microsoft and Vogue, to name just a few.

RVZ Paris PHOTOGRAPHY / CAMERA / LIGHTING

For clients looking to shoot in Paris, Morocco, or anywhere else for that matter, RVZ's team of 35 professionals has 25 years of experience and is available for all production needs. Clients can now rent the latest IQ250 PhaseOne digital Back while the company has also extended its Mamiya 645DF+ lens range with the Schneider-Kreuznach leaf shutter 240mm 1:2.8.

Equipment includes: Flashes - Profoto, Broncolor, Briese, Elinchrom, Multiblitz; Digital capture - Phase One, Canon, Nikon, Hasselblad, Leaf; Cameras - Red Epic M, Red Epic Dragon, Scarlet, Canon EOS C300, Arri Alexa; HMI / Tungsten - Arri, K5600, Desisti, Dedolight; Fluos / LEDs - Kino Flo, Lite Panels, Smart Light, Trucolor, Cineled; Softboxes, frames, textiles, effects and specific accessories including wind and smoke machines. Props, make-up stations, folding tables, chairs and boxes, ollies and accessories, lighting grips, stands, power distribution, trucks, location vans and generators.
